探索CDN的奥秘,动态与静态CDN的区别与应用,动态cdn和静态cdn有什么区别?

Time:2024年11月01日 Read:16 评论:42 作者:y21dr45

在数字化时代,内容的快速加载和高效分发是用户体验的关键因素之一,内容分发网络(CDN)作为实现这一目标的重要工具,其核心在于通过网络将内容分布到多个地理位置的服务器上,从而缩短用户与内容之间的距离,提高访问速度和可靠性,在实际应用中,CDN通常分为两种主要类型:动态CDN和静态CDN,尽管它们都旨在优化内容的交付,但它们的工作原理、优势以及适用场景存在显著差异,本文将深入探讨这两种CDN技术的特点、优缺点以及最佳应用场景,以帮助读者更好地理解和选择适合自己需求的CDN解决方案。

探索CDN的奥秘,动态与静态CDN的区别与应用,动态cdn和静态cdn有什么区别?

动态CDN:实时数据更新与个性化服务

定义与原理

动态CDN,也称为实时CDN或智能CDN,通过实时监控网络状况和用户行为,动态调整内容分发策略,它利用先进的数据分析和机器学习技术,预测用户请求并提前将相关内容推送至靠近用户的节点,从而实现低延迟和高可用性的内容交付。

优势

1、自适应调整:能够根据实时网络状况和用户需求,自动调整内容分发策略,确保用户始终获得最优体验。

2、弹性扩展:具备强大的扩展能力,可以根据流量变化动态增加或减少资源分配,有效应对突发流量高峰。

3、个性化服务:通过分析用户行为和偏好,提供个性化的内容推荐和加速服务,提升用户满意度。

缺点

1、成本较高:由于需要持续的数据分析和机器学习模型训练,动态CDN的运营成本相对较高。

2、复杂性增加:管理和维护动态CDN需要专业的技术支持团队,增加了系统的复杂性和运维难度。

适用场景

动态CDN非常适合那些对内容更新频率高、用户行为变化大、对服务质量要求极高的应用场景,视频流媒体、在线游戏、电子商务等平台,这些场景下的内容更新速度快,用户对加载时间和响应速度的要求极高。

静态CDN:预缓存内容与固定位置分发

定义与原理

静态CDN则专注于预缓存热门内容并将其存储在多个地理位置的服务器上,当用户请求内容时,系统会从距离用户最近的节点获取内容,以减少传输时间和延迟,这种类型的CDN通常不涉及实时数据更新或个性化服务。

优势

1、成本效益:相对于动态CDN,静态CDN的建设和维护成本较低,因为它不需要复杂的数据分析和机器学习模型。

2、易于管理:由于不涉及实时数据处理,静态CDN的管理和维护相对简单,适合资源有限的组织使用。

3、稳定性高预先缓存且固定不变,静态CDN提供了高度稳定的内容交付服务。

缺点

1、灵活性不足:静态CDN无法应对内容更新或用户需求的变化,适用于内容相对稳定的应用环境。

2、性能受限:在面对突发流量或用户分布广泛的情况下,静态CDN的表现不如动态CDN灵活和有效。

适用场景

静态CDN更适合于那些内容更新较少、用户访问模式相对固定的应用场景,新闻网站、博客平台、企业官网等,这些场景下的内容变化不大,用户对内容的新鲜度要求不高。

综合比较与最佳实践建议

在选择适合的CDN解决方案时,组织应根据自身业务需求、预算和技术能力进行综合考虑,对于追求高性能、高可靠性和个性化服务的应用场景(如视频流媒体和在线游戏),动态CDN无疑是更优的选择,而对于注重成本控制、易于管理和稳定性的场景(如新闻网站和企业官网),静态CDN则更为合适,一些组织可能会选择结合使用动态和静态CDN的策略,通过动态CDN处理实时数据更新和个性化服务的需求,而将静态内容交由静态CDN处理,以此兼顾性能和成本效益。

随着互联网技术的不断进步和用户需求的日益多样化,CDN技术也在不断演进和发展,理解并合理运用动态与静态CDN的特性和优势,可以帮助组织更有效地满足不同场景下的用户体验需求,进而在激烈的市场竞争中脱颖而出。

标签: 动态cdn和静态cdn 
排行榜
关于我们
「好主机」服务器测评网专注于为用户提供专业、真实的服务器评测与高性价比推荐。我们通过硬核性能测试、稳定性追踪及用户真实评价,帮助企业和个人用户快速找到最适合的服务器解决方案。无论是云服务器、物理服务器还是企业级服务器,好主机都是您值得信赖的选购指南!
快捷菜单1
服务器测评
VPS测评
VPS测评
服务器资讯
服务器资讯
扫码关注
鲁ICP备2022041413号-1